Oslo Gardermoen (OSL) is Norway’s main international gateway and typically serves as the city’s premium hub, hosting full-service carriers and several low-cost airlines on long- and short-haul routes. It sits about 50 km north of central Oslo; express trains take around 20–22 minutes while regional trains or buses can be 25–40 minutes depending on stops, with fares usually varying by service class. For budget-conscious travelers, secondary airports such as Sandefjord Torp (approx. 110 km south) and Moss Rygge (seasonal/charter use) can be cheaper but involve longer transfers. Pros of Gardermoen include frequent services and good rail links; cons can be the distance from downtown and occasional higher transfer costs.
Nice Côte d’Azur Airport is the region’s main international gateway and typically serves a mix of legacy carriers and numerous low-cost airlines, making it both a premium hub for long-haul connections and a value option for European routes. Located about 7–8 km west of Nice city center, transfer options include the tram and buses (roughly 20–30 minutes, fares usually modest), taxis (15–25 minutes depending on traffic, higher fares), and car hire. Pros: close proximity to the Promenade des Anglais and regular connections across Europe; cons: can be busy in summer and security/boarding waits may be longer at peak times. Overall it balances convenience with seasonal crowds and a range of price levels.

Often the best time to buy tickets from Oslo to Nice is 2 months before departure.
Based on statistics over the past years, the lowest prices for flights from Oslo to Nice can be found flying in these months: May, June, October.
The fastest flights from Oslo to Nice start from 2 hours 50 minutes in the air.
The following airlines operate direct flights on the route Oslo — Nice: Norwegian Air Shuttle, Scandinavian Airlines, Norwegian Air International

The distance between Oslo and Nice is 1822km (1130 miles). There are 8 direct flights from Oslo to Nice. Oslo and Nice are in the same time zone. Flights from Oslo begin at 8:00 AM. The latest flight from Oslo departs at 5:20 PM
